Hyderabad, May 19: State Congress President Minority department Mr. Mohammad Siraj Uddin on Wednesday submitted a written memorandum to Mr. Ghulam Nabi Azad highlighting the injustices meted out to Muslims in the state. It also focused destruction of Waqf properties and preference given to non Congress people in distribution of posts ignoring Muslim leaders of the party. A copy of the memorandum was also sent to Congress president Mrs. Sonia Gandhi and Prime Minister Dr. Manmohan Singh.
It should be recalled that Mr. Mohammad Siraj Uddin had called on Union Minister for Health and In-charge of the state Congress Affairs Mr. Ghulab Nabi Azad on May 16 at Lake View Gust House along with a delegation of Muslim leaders of Congress and had discussed on Muslim issues. Mr. Ghulam Nabi Azad had directed them to submit a written report regarding the issues and waqf properties, on which State Congress President Minority department submitted a written memorandum to Mr. Ghulam Nabi Azad on Wednesday in which injustices done to Muslims right from the Grampanchayat to state level posts are underlined. It was claimed in the memorandum that this is the reason why the Muslims who are said to be the backbone of Congress
feel alienated from the Congress.
The memorandum also gave a detailed report regarding destruction and acquisition of waqf properties by the government. It also discussed various problems faced by the Muslim community in the state.
